At a legislative conference in Cambridge, Ohio, Bruce Katz stressed the importance of cities and metro areas to the state’s overall prosperity. Acknowledging the decline of Ohio’s older industrial cities, Katz noted the area’s many assets and argued for a focus on innovation, human capital, infrastructure, and quality communities as means to revitalize the region.
